Just to let you know, mplayer from debian main works with
"-ac tremor", too, so after having intone in main you don't
need any self compiled stuff!
> > Now they could also be put to actual Debian repository.
> Sebastian, are these packages ready for main?
I just added a patch, which make the bluetooth buttons work.
(Debian returns proper names for them, e.g. "XF86AudioPlay"
instead of "Keycode-171")
So I think intone is ready for main - 100% of the features, no
lintian warnings.
